Application of the Cartier Operator in Coding Theory
Abstract
The $a$-number is an invariant of the isomorphism class of the $p$-torsion group scheme. We use the Cartier operator on $H^0(\mathcal{A}_2,\Omega^1)$ to find a closed formula for the $a$-number of the form $\mathcal{A}_2 = v(Y^{\sqrt{q}}+Y-x^{\frac{\sqrt{q}+1}{2}})$ where $q=p^s$ over the finite field $\mathbb{F}_{q^2}$. The application of the computed $a$-number in coding theory is illustrated by the relationship between the algebraic properties of the curve and the parameters of codes that are supported by it.
